Nigerian content creator and streamer Peller has reacted angrily to a young woman’s claim that she is pregnant for him, offering a ₦5 million reward to anyone who helps locate her.
Peller addressed the matter during a recent livestream with his wife, Jarvis, after the woman reportedly contacted him privately and claimed that she was carrying his child.
During the livestream, the content creator described the woman as wanted and appealed to anyone who knows her whereabouts to provide information that could lead to her being located.
“That girl who says she’s pregnant for me, they will find her and catch her. The girl is wanted. Anybody who sees her, please bring her. I’m going to reward you with ₦5 million,” Peller said.
He also expressed anger over the allegation and said he would pursue the matter if the woman was found.
“If they catch her, I’ll make sure they lock her up. Even if her family begs, I won’t answer,” he added.
The development follows claims that the woman reached out to Peller through his direct messages to inform him of the alleged pregnancy.
She reportedly claimed that Peller told her to terminate the pregnancy after she contacted him. That part of the allegation has not been independently verified, and Peller’s latest comments did not establish whether he had any relationship with the woman or whether the pregnancy claim was genuine.
The content creator’s reaction has since generated discussion on social media, particularly over his decision to offer ₦5 million for information that could help locate the woman.
Peller has previously faced public attention over speculation surrounding his relationship with Jarvis, but his latest comments were specifically directed at the woman who allegedly claimed to be pregnant for him.
